In a chilling turn of events, four vehicles belonging to a BJP supporter were set ablaze outside a residence in Chirayinkeezhu, prompting an urgent police investigation.
The incident, which took place around midnight, saw an autorickshaw, two motorcycles, and a scooter completely gutted by flames, according to the FIR.
Authorities are examining CCTV footage revealing two helmeted individuals near the scene, as suspicions swirl around election-linked motives. A previous arson attempt at the residence of the supporter's brother amplifies these concerns.
